States must focus on sustaining competitiveness: CII

Excelsior Correspondent
JAMMU, Mar 18: Ajay Shankar, Chairman, Expert Committee Constituted by DIPP & Former Secretary, DIPP, Government of India, today stressed the need to create consensus on mainstream skilling as a part of normal education.
He was speaking at the panel discussion on North – Sustaining the Competitive Edge during the CII conference on ‘Building North for a Better Tomorrow’, organized by Confederation of Indian Industry (CII) as part of CII Northern Region’s Annual Regional Meeting, here today.
Mr Shankar said that provisions should be made for affordable rental workers’ housing as a part of infrastructure development. He said it was necessary to work for growth of the food processing sector and agro-based industries for regional growth. “We should be more ambitious and aggressive, and then only our dream of a better North can be achieved,” Mr Shankar remarked.
Shreekant Somany, Chairman, CII Northern Region & Chairman & Managing Director, Somany Ceramics Ltd, gave an overview of how the Northern Region occupies a prominent position in the national economic landscape.
Jayant Krishna, CEO NSDC, stressed the need to continuously upgrade curriculum and infrastructure of Technical/Vocational Education system. “Skilling should become an integral part of MGNREGA,” he suggested.
Vinayak Chatterjee, Chairman, CII Taskforce on Railways & Chairman, Feedback Infra Pvt Ltd said, “Since the industry suffers in a land-locked Northern Region, speedy implementation of Delhi-Mumbai Industrial Corridor and Dedicated Freight Corridors is the need of the hour.
Sumant Sinha, Chairman & CEO, ReNew Power Ventures Pvt Ltd, said that the Northern states should give efforts to utilise the untapped renewable energy potential.  Sheikh Imran, Chairman CII Jammu & Kashmir State Council, said that the people of J&K are highly skilled in the art of weaving and handicraft design, which provides opportunities for setting up new textile and handicraft units in the State.
Eminent speakers from the industry and the Government, including Al Gore, former Vice President of USA, Sumit Mazumder, president, CII and others also shared their perspective at the conference.
